Output 63b03874724573ec0987a7c3d6e1ec3fe37e00b86febf18dfbd9e772879a80ac:0

value
42239410
script pubkey
OP_0 OP_PUSHBYTES_20 5f1009f3ff3a36da7748e37096900fa0919537b1
address
bc1qtugqnull8gmd5a6gudcfdyq05zge2da3lej8cj
transaction
63b03874724573ec0987a7c3d6e1ec3fe37e00b86febf18dfbd9e772879a80ac
confirmations
30031
spent
true